What is a French Door Refrigerator?

A French door refrigerator is identified by two doors that open outside from the center to reveal the refrigerator area, while a different drawer located at the bottom offers access to the freezer compartment. This design enables easier access to regularly utilized products and maximizes the usable area within the fridge.

French door refrigerators include a myriad of advantages that cater to modern-day culinary needs:

  1. Space Efficiency

    • The design inherently provides more usable space. The bottom freezer drawer includes larger products and a more organized storage system.
  2. Accessibility

    • Side-by-side doors permit for easier access to often utilized items at eye level. No more bending down to grab products, thanks to the eye-level temperature-controlled compartments.
  3. Trendy Aesthetics

    • French door refrigerators provide a modern look that complements many cooking area styles, boosting general kitchen area design.
  4. Versatile Storage Options

    • Lots of models feature adjustable shelves, bins, and compartments customized for a range of food items, making organization simple.
  5. Smart Features

    • High-end models might integrate wise functions, allowing users to manage temperatures and food materials remotely.

In spite of their numerous benefits, French door refrigerators come with some disadvantages that possible purchasers must consider:

  1. Price Point

    • French door designs are usually more expensive upfront compared to leading freezer or side-by-side options.
  2. Maintenance Costs

    • High-end features might cause increased upkeep costs, specifically if repair work are needed for advanced temperature control systems.
  3. Depth and Fit

    • These refrigerators tend to take up more space in depth, which might not appropriate for smaller kitchen areas or areas with minimal area.
  4. Freezer Space

    • Bottom-freezer drawers can need bending down to gain access to items, which may be not practical for some users.

1. Are French door refrigerators more energy-efficient than other designs?

Yes, numerous French door refrigerators are developed with energy efficiency in mind, particularly models with Energy Star ratings.

2. How do I maintain a French door refrigerator?

Regular maintenance includes cleaning the coils, changing air and water filters as needed, and checking door seals to ensure they are airtight.

3. Can I fit a French door fridge in a little cooking area?

Yes, however make sure to measure your area and inspect the door swing clearance before acquiring. Slimmer designs are also available.

4. Do all French door refrigerators include ice makers?

Not all models are equipped with ice makers, so it's essential to examine requirements before buying.
